P2P应用的体系结构

tracker服务器  时间:2021-01-11  阅读:()
及其对网络行为的影响mk@cernet.
edu.
cn2006.
07.
1212-Jul-06P2PArchitecture1概要P2P应用的体系结构P2POverlay网络行为发展趋势机遇和挑战12-Jul-06P2PArchitecture2BitTorrent–Whattrulyseparatesthegreatprogrammersfromthejourneymanprogrammersisarchitecture.
What'spuzzlingisthatarchitectureappearstobeoneofthesimplestpartsofthewholeprocess,requiringinmostcaseslittlemorethansomepencilandpapercalculationsandawillingnesstochange.
BramCohen,2004-12-19,http://bramcohen.
livejournal.
com/4563.
htmlBT体系结构的组成部分–发布网站–Tracker服务器–用户:Tit-for-tat12-Jul-06P2PArchitecture3BitTorrent的基本原理Webpagewithlinkto.
torrentABCPeer[Leech]DownloaderPeer[Seed]Peer[Leech]TrackerWebServer.
torrentGet-AnnounceResponse-Peer-ListHand-ShakeHand-ShakePiecesPiecesFrom:mnl.
cs.
sunysb.
edu/home/karthik/BitTorrent/BToverview.
ppt12-Jul-06P2PArchitecture4eDonkey/Overnet/eMule/Kad目录服务BitTorrent–依靠网站发布eDonkey/eMule–依靠目录服务器–Built-insearch(directory)serviceOvernet/Kad–依靠DHT效果BT–快而短暂适合热门新资源的传播eDonkey/Overnet/eMule/Kad–慢而持久更有利于信息资源传播的多样化–原因:资源交换模型and/or检索能力OpenTopic:Modelingdoesn'tstop12-Jul-06P2PArchitecture5SkypeAP2PVoIPSolution–KaZaA发明者的后续杰作–技术特点基于KaZaAOverlay网络–非结构化的P2Poverlay–普通节点和超节点(SN)–普通节点通过超节点连接到网络中心化的认证服务基于iLBC的语音编码–InternetLowBitrateCodecILBC(http://rfc3951.
x42.
com/)Accordingto:GeoffreyFox'sPresentation12-Jul-06P2PArchitecture6Skype的体系结构From:GeoffreyFox'sPresentation每个客户端维护关于超节点的缓存本地维护好友名单持续发现和建立节点列表通过DHT和泛洪相结合的方式搜索超节点给用户提供代理所有Skype消息是加密的12-Jul-06P2PArchitecture7P2POverlaysP2P和Overlay的关系–Overlay不一定是P2P的E.
g.
SETI@Home–P2P应用一般形成Overlay资源对等传输的Overlay–应用层节点之间的存储转发资源定位和查找的Overlay–CAN–Pastry–Chord–Kademlia12-Jul-06P2PArchitecture8资源传输Overlay对物理网络的影响CaseStudy–部署流媒体直播系统的方案764kbps单播单服务器–1Kusers(受限于局域网带宽)–延迟:5~20秒组播单服务器–取决于用户的分布单播多服务器–几乎与服务器数目成正比–可以作为组播的替代方案P2P–取决于用户的分布–延迟:数秒~数分钟迂回的转发路径12-Jul-06P2PArchitecture9模型QuickTimeandaTIFF(LZW)decompressorareneededtoseethispicture.
QuickTimeandaTIFF(LZW)decompressorareneededtoseethispicture.
QuickTimeandaTIFF(LZW)decompressorareneededtoseethispicture.
QuickTimeandaTIFF(LZW)decompressorareneededtoseethispicture.
12-Jul-06P2PArchitecture10仿真QuickTimeandaTIFF(LZW)decompressorareneededtoseethispicture.
QuickTimeandaTIFF(LZW)decompressorareneededtoseethispicture.
QuickTimeandaTIFF(LZW)decompressorareneededtoseethispicture.
QuickTimeandaTIFF(LZW)decompressorareneededtoseethispicture.
12-Jul-06P2PArchitecture11仿真(续)QuickTimeandaTIFF(LZW)decompressorareneededtoseethispicture.
QuickTimeandaTIFF(LZW)decompressorareneededtoseethispicture.
P2POverlay传输网络的行为–大规模Overlay的传输可能导致物理网络发生拥塞–迂回的传输路径是降低网络承载用户通信能力的主要原因拥塞的程度与传输路径的平均迂回程度正相关OpenTopic:Overlay传输网络的缓冲和拥塞控制12-Jul-06P2PArchitecture12发展趋势和DHT的关系–Decentralizationoflookupservice–ForthepeoplethataimtostopP2P,theyhaveturnedacentralizedsystemlikeNapster–easilycontrolled,easilymonitored–intoafullydecentralizedsystemintheformofKazaa,aswellasafragmentedecosystemofthousandsofcentralizedserversthroughBitTorrent.
Thiswasprobablyabaddecision.
Monkeymethodsresearchgroup,2005-01-10,http://monkeymethods.
org/pubs/is-bittorrent-dead-centralization-analysis.
htm安全、隐私和反流量工程问题–OpenTopic:De-patterning端口随机化传输行为的随机化UDPvs.
TCP12-Jul-06P2PArchitecture13PlanetaryP2PApplicationModelP2P的启示–eMuleFileslicesFriendchannel–PlanetLabComputationresource"slices""Hilarityensues!
"——新的P2P体系结构–一个用户拥有多个节点地理上分散的虚拟机–每个节点独立与其他用户交互传统的P2P模式–同一用户的节点之间相互协同最小平均分发速率vs.
最小优先分发速率同一用户的节点之间优化overlay和物理网络的关系影响–Most-selfishbehavior–Blocking12-Jul-06P2PArchitecture14关系和OpenSource的关系–P2P是开源软件传播的理想方式E.
g.
Linuxdistribution–P2P软件一般通过开源方式发布BitTorrenteMule和IPv6的关系–End-to-endtransparency问题:从IPv4网络过渡解决方案:IPv4-over-IPv612-Jul-06P2PArchitecture15IPv6网络支持P2P过渡的条件IPv4全局地址映射到IPv6地址空间12-Jul-06P2PArchitecture16命题ISP对P2P的态度–正方:容许P2P提高网络利用率,应该鼓励–反方:容许P2P造成网络拥塞,破坏公平使用,应该限制教育者对P2P的态度–正方:学生使用P2P有利身心健康–反方:学生使用P2P有碍身心健康Internet技术团体对P2P的态度–正方:发展P2P技术是我国信息网络技术的战略储备–反方:限制P2P技术有利于把有限的基础设施资源用到刀刃上政府对P2P的态度–反方:破坏知识产权保护,应该取缔–反方:传播不健康资料,应该取缔–反方:越来越管不了了,应该取缔–方:有所谓吗无所谓吧12-Jul-06P2PArchitecture17挑战和机遇费用模型和VIP路由–占用带宽的不公平性问题并非只有P2P存在的问题P2P由于带宽利用率提高使问题显得更加严重"抓大放小"的原则真实地址–资源使用和发布的法律责任并非只有P2P存在的问题P2P由于传播效率高、源地址分布广使问题显得更加严重

柚子互联(34元),湖北十堰高防, 香港 1核1G 5M

柚子互联官网商家介绍柚子互联(www.19vps.cn)本次给大家带来了盛夏促销活动,本次推出的活动是湖北十堰高防产品,这次老板也人狠话不多丢了一个6.5折优惠券而且还是续费同价,稳撸。喜欢的朋友可以看看下面的活动详情介绍,自从站长这么久以来柚子互联从19年开始算是老商家了。六五折优惠码:6kfUGl07活动截止时间:2021年9月30日客服QQ:207781983本次仅推荐部分套餐,更多套餐可进...

CloudCone(20美元/年)大硬盘VPS云服务器,KVM虚拟架构,1核心1G内存1Gbps带宽

近日CloudCone商家对旗下的大硬盘VPS云服务器进行了少量库存补货,也是悄悄推送了一批便宜VPS云服务器产品,此前较受欢迎的特价20美元/年、1核心1G内存1Gbps带宽的VPS云服务器也有少量库存,有需要美国便宜大硬盘VPS云服务器的朋友可以关注一下。CloudCone怎么样?CloudCone服务器好不好?CloudCone值不值得购买?CloudCone是一家成立于2017年的美国服务...

RangCloud19.8元/月,香港cn2云主机,美国西雅图高防云主机28元/月起

rangcloud怎么样?rangcloud是去年年初开办的国人商家,RangCloud是一家以销售NAT起步,后续逐渐开始拓展到VPS及云主机业务,目前有中国香港、美国西雅图、韩国NAT、广州移动、江门移动、镇江BGP、山东联通、山东BGP等机房。目前,RangCloud提供香港CN2线路云服务器,电信走CN2、联通移动直连,云主机采用PCle固态硬盘,19.8元/月起,支持建站使用;美国高防云...

tracker服务器为你推荐
云主机租用云主机到底是什么?租用以后该如何使用?美国虚拟主机美国云主机与美国虚拟主机有什么区别域名注册申请域名怎么申请和注册广东虚拟主机西部数码和中国万网,哪家的虚拟主机哪个好,用过的说说?美国vps主机我用的美国VPS主机429元/月,感觉好贵,请问有比较便宜点的吗?国内ip代理谁给我几个北京或国内的IP代理啊,高分,能用的成都虚拟空间空间服务商那个好asp网站空间求申请ASP免费空间地址的网址虚拟主机管理系统推荐几个适合windows的免费虚拟主机管理系统北京虚拟主机北京服务好的虚拟主机代理商介绍几个?
cm域名注册 主机域名 私服服务器租用 景安vps 如何注销域名备案 阿里云os hawkhost优惠码 20g硬盘 牛人与腾讯客服对话 免费全能空间 cdn联盟 100m独享 卡巴斯基免费试用 33456 linux使用教程 免费外链相册 上海电信测速网站 英国伦敦 服务器论坛 永久免费空间 更多